Summit, NJ, USA
27 days ago
Contract Controls Engineer

Job Title: Contract Controls Engineer
Location: Summit, NJ
Type: Contract (3-6 months)
  CONTRACT CONTROLS ENGINEER
RESPONSIBILITIES Design, programming, testing, implementation, and troubleshooting of Python based control systems, while adhering to company standards.  Develop and test programs on Raspberry Pi 3 and 4, with Sleepy Pi 2 add-on, using Python (2.x and 3.x). Develop Python algorithm for dynamic database updates that do not require Raspberry Pi power-down. Develop and implement Python PID auto-tuning algorithm by manual implementation or using existing control or PID dedicated libraries, for dynamically adjusting PID values based on motor characteristics (DC and stepper motors). Refactor existing codebase to improve structure, readability, and maintainability by organizing code files and adding detailed documentation and comments. QUALIFICATIONS 2+ years of experience in writing programs on Raspberry Pi 3 and 4, with Sleepy Pi 2 add-on, using Python (2.x and 3.x) from scratch. 2+ years of experience in using I2C and SPI communication protocols with Raspberry Pi. 1+ years of experience in development and implementation of Python PID auto-tuning algorithm by manual implementation or using existing Control library or PID dedicated libraries, for dynamically adjusting PID values. 1+ years of experience in setup and use of SQLite Database on Raspberry Pi. Move materials and tools weighing up to 50 pounds. Use and operate tools, wires, and small components. Ability to identify color-coded wiring and detect sound.  PREFERRED EXPERIENCE 2+ years of experience in using version control systems (e.g., Git). 1+ years of experience in working with electrical circuits and troubleshooting at undergraduate II level. 1+ years of hands-on experience with DC and stepper motors, including control and feedback mechanisms. 1+ years of experience in either of PID control loop auto-tuning methods: Ziegler-Nichols or Cohen-Coon. 1+ years of experience in other programming languages (e.g., C/C++). 
System One, and its subsidiaries including Joulé, ALTA IT Services, and Mountain Ltd., are leaders in delivering outsourced services and workforce solutions across North America. We help clients get work done more efficiently and economically, without compromising quality. System One not only serves as a valued partner for our clients, but we offer eligible employees health and welfare benefits coverage options including medical, dental, vision, spending accounts, life insurance, voluntary plans, as well as participation in a 401(k) plan.

System One is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, age, national origin, disability, family care or medical leave status, genetic information, veteran status, marital status, or any other characteristic protected by applicable federal, state, or local law.

#M1
 


System One, and its subsidiaries including Joulé, ALTA IT Services, TeamPeople, and Mountain Ltd., are leaders in delivering outsourced services and workforce solutions across North America. We help clients get work done more efficiently and economically, without compromising quality. System One not only serves as a valued partner for our clients, but we offer eligible employees health and welfare benefits coverage options including medical, dental, vision, spending accounts, life insurance, voluntary plans, as well as participation in a 401(k) plan.


System One is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, age, national origin, disability, family care or medical leave status, genetic information, veteran status, marital status, or any other characteristic protected by applicable federal, state, or local law.


Por favor confirme su dirección de correo electrónico: Send Email